MAGROW on Community Health Advocacy

"MAGROW is one of the mapped stakeholders to mobilized the Community Health Awareness', says the Provincial Health Office (PHO) of Compostela Valley Province.

During the Orientation on Community Mobilization for Compostela Valley, Davao Del Sur and Zamboanga del Sur on July 7-10,2010 at East Asia Royale Hotel , General Santos City, one of the main topics is the participation of the non-government orientation to include MAGROW-MPC which has a total of more than 3,000 members. Ms. Lanie Decatoria-Sarco, Industrial Relations and Development Officer of MAGROW has represented the cooperative to the said seminar.

This activity was funded by the UsAid (From the American People) in cooperation with the Health Pro which aimed to provide technical assistance (TA) to national and local counterparts, partners and CAs in the field of deisgning, managing and evaluating strategic communication program for behaviour change.



Participants came from varied organizations to include the City and Provincial Health Office, Local Government units, Non-Government Organizations and Barangay Health Organizations from the provinces of Compostela Valley, Davao del Sur and Zamboanga Del Sur.



The said orientation discussed on the enhancing of organizational skills of comunity health advocates, Core of Community Advocates, Health promotion activities and guidance on Health Classes and Counselling on Family Planning, Tuberculosis, Maternal, Neo-Natal, Child, Health and Nutrition.

MAGROW will also be initiating an orientation to selected Labor Pool workers and their partners through the Provincial and Municipal Health Office by August.
